#047304 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#047304 is composed of 1.6% red, 45.1% green and 1.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 96.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 96.5% yellow and 54.9% black. It has a hue angle of 120 degrees, a saturation of 93.3% and a lightness of 23.3%. #047304 color hex could be obtained by blending #08e608 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006600.

Shades and Tints of #047304
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000100 is the darkest color, while #edfeed is the lightest one.

Tones of #047304
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3b3c3b is the less saturated color, while #047304 is the most saturated one.
